This project aims to enhance the power efficiency of Liquid Crystal Displays (LCDs) by developing algorithms that reduce color breakup artifacts. The focus is on improving display technology to minimize energy consumption, particularly in the context of increasing demand for electronic devices in Europe and China.
There is growing awareness that our hunger for energy has a large impact on the environment. A significant amount of energy is consumed by electronic devices that we use.
In Europe we consume 210,000 MWh a day watching TV.
In China, power consumption will increase dramatically in the future.
Liquid Cristal Display (LCD) is the major display technology for the coming 10 years.
Although LCDs offer many benefits, they provide a relatively poor system solution in terms of power-efficiency.
